OVERVIEW
The Susan S. Morrison School of Nursing (SON) in the Morrison Family College of Health at the University of St. Thomas in St. Paul, Minnesota, invites applicants for a tenure-track assistant professor position. We seek applicants who are committed to teaching excellence, both within a traditional BSN and accelerated pre-licensure MSN program. The successful applicant will teach a range of nursing courses and current needs prioritize subject matter expertise in pathophysiology, pharmacology, acute and chronic care, and health assessment. In addition, applicants will provide academic advising to students and participate in service activities in the school, college, and university. The standard teaching load for this position is six courses in an academic year. The successful applicant will develop and pursue an active research agenda, and all areas of nursing research/scholarship will be considered. We seek candidates who are committed to fostering inclusive learning environments, interested in working as part of an interprofessional team, and eager to develop a scholarly agenda that engages students in meaningful ways.

Qualifications
Minimum Qualifications:
- PhD (U.S. or Foreign Equivalent) in Nursing or closely related field, Doctor of Nursing Practice (DNP) (U.S. or Foreign Equivalent) Completion of all coursework with dissertation in progress will also be considered
- Alternatively, a candidate with an EdD, PhD in an area unrelated to Nursing is acceptable if the candidate holds a bachelor's or master/s degree (U.S. or foreign equivalent) in Nursing.
- Must be eligible for RN licensure in the state of Minnesota.
- Evidence of teaching effectiveness in a higher education setting or as a clinical educator within an acute care setting.
- The capacity to conduct and disseminate peer-reviewed research, with the potential to develop a robust research agenda at the University of St. Thomas.
- Medical-surgical nursing practice experience
